Mobile County commissioners tell residents they can’t halt $6 billion data center

4 hours ago 1
Melissa Bailey of rural Calvert in Mobile County speaks in opposition to a proposed $6 billion Beacon Data Centers project on 650 acres between Highway 43 and Shepard House Road in North Mobile County. Bailey requested the Mobile County Commission, on Monday, July 13, 2026, to consider taking some action against the project. County commissioners, however, said they did not have the authority to do anything.

Data centers are emerging nationwide as companies race to capitalize on artificial intelligence, even as residents in Mobile County worry the trend could disturb bear habitats or cause cattle to become sterile.
